18 Unreported Names of Those Killed in War
Razm.info continues to publish the names of those killed in the Artsakh war since September 27, whose information has not yet been disclosed by official sources.
Following the publication of the first and second parts of the series, the Defense Army has released two more lists, totaling 135 deceased individuals. Six of them were included in the previous parts of this series. They are:
- Hovhannes Markosyan (born 1994, Hrazdan), a volunteer, killed in Jabrayil on October 15.
- Alen Aghazaryan (born 1990), killed on the northern front on October 4.
- Manuk Margaryan (born 1985), a volunteer.
- Gor Sargsyan (born 1985), a volunteer.
- Sargis Azaryan (born 1992, Parpi), killed on November 8 in the battles for Shushi.
- Mkhtiar Asryan, killed on November 9 in Shushi.
- Arthur Aghajanyan (born 1984), a reservist, killed on October 10 in Fizuli.
- Nver Hyusnunts (born 1986, Martakert), a volunteer, killed in November in the Red Market.
- Georgy Arshakyan (born 1996, Yerevan), an officer in the reserve, voluntary fighter, killed in the battles for Shushi.
- Arev Aduryan (born 2000), a conscripted soldier, medic.
- Jora Sargsyan (born 2000), killed on October 23.
- Jora Ketryan (born 1996, Mayisyan), senior lieutenant.
- Edgar Barseghyan (born 1993, Armavir), a volunteer.
- Meruzhan Martirosyan (born 1987), killed on October 28 in the defense of Sheikh village.
- Lyova Khachatryan (born 1991), captain, peacekeeper, killed in November.
- Arthur Arakelyan (father) and Kamo Arakelyan (son), killed on October 29.
- Haik Gharsyan, senior lieutenant, killed in Varanda.
